Batman Miniature Game Prisoner 05

Finished off Prisoner 05 this week or Smoke Bomb prisoner as he is otherwise known as. I have had a couple of prisoners part painted since I did the last few prisoners for the last Batman tournament. I have a wide variety of stuff on the paint bench and fancied something easy to work on and finish I just picked them up and did some more work on them.

I really do like the Blackgate Prison set 2 the sculpts are a little chunkier and as such seem easier to paint up. I only have 4 prisoners left now. Little Spark (nearly finished), Turk, Stick and Axe Prisoners. I also have one of the special tournament cards B.A and a spare Stick prisoner to use for the model. I am currently mulling over how to add chains for his necklaces and a feather for his ear :D

The main use of this guy is his smoke bombs they restrict line of sight prevent people from moving and can generally be really annoying. The pistol is a nice back up weapon but he is quite squishy stat wise.
